D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ION

Motion by the plaintiff, inter alia, for leave to appeal to the Court of Appeals from the decision and order on motion of this Court dated November 30, 2010, which determined his motion, inter alia, for leave to appeal to this Court from an order of the Appellate Term, Second, Eleventh, and Thirteenth Judicial Districts, dated July 2, 2010, which affirmed an order of the Civil Court of the City of New York, Kings County, entered May 30, 2008, and for poor person relief.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in opposition thereto, it is

ORDERED that the motion is denied.

COVELLO, J.P., LOTT, ROMAN and MILLER, JJ., concur.
